Default 2.7T aircon fan

I have a 2000 A6 2.7T. When the aircon is on the fan nearest the front grill seems to make quit a noise. The bearings are ok and I cant see anything actually wrong with it except for seems to run really fast so it sounds like a jet. If the aircom is on its on. It slows down every now and then but before it stops moving its off again at high speed.
Is this normal on this model ?

Default RE: 2.7T aircon fan

Turn the vehicle off and attempt to turn the electric fan closest to the engine. Its the one on the passenger side of the vehicle. Ill bet youll find it wont turn. Theres a piece of rubber that falls in there and binds up the fan. Sometimes you can take the rubber piece out and all is well. Sometimes the fan and the fan control module get damaged and both must be replaced.

Default RE: 2.7T aircon fan

Thankyou Dankhound you were spot on with the rubber thing. I pulled a foot long piece of rubber out of the fan. It now spins freely.
